Output 51ef86dc101ec4a23e896a8a8976784ed78040f2481878b224ace3588eee169f:91

value
3010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7058e085dbef4f78d6a51108bb15035743106ae6 OP_EQUAL
address
3Bw45KALGyN8EzB2vTV9zfmLa6FCDfYb2Q
transaction
51ef86dc101ec4a23e896a8a8976784ed78040f2481878b224ace3588eee169f
spent
true